Why Fall Is the Best Time for Septic System Service in Colorado
When the ground freezes, access to your septic tank becomes far more difficult, and in some cases, impossible without excavation. Scheduling fall septic service means you avoid emergency pumping and minimize the risk of winter breakdowns.
A full septic tank in freezing weather can lead to:
- Frozen or cracked lines from blocked flow
- Backup into your home’s drains or toilets
- Odors escaping through your yard or plumbing
- Overflow that contaminates nearby groundwater
According to the EPA, one in five U.S. households depends on a septic system, and many neglect regular pumping. The EPA recommends septic tanks be inspected every 3 years and pumped every 3–5 years depending on use.
What Are the 5 Warning Signs Your Septic Tank Is Full?
Here’s how to know when your system needs attention:
- Slow Drains – If sinks and tubs are taking longer to empty, your tank could be reaching capacity.
- Unpleasant Odors – Sewage smells near drains or outdoors often indicate a problem.
- Lush Patches of Grass – Unusually green or soggy spots over your drain field may suggest an overflow.
- Sewage Backup – If wastewater is coming up from drains or toilets, your tank may be overdue for pumping.
- Gurgling Sounds – Bubbling noises when flushing or draining water are a classic red flag.

In addition to professional help, here are key tasks homeowners should complete:
Task | Why It Matters |
Pump the tank | Prevents freezing, overflow, and winter backups |
Inspect for cracks or leaks | Cold can worsen structural damage |
Add insulation if needed | Straw or mulch over the tank can prevent freezing |
Limit water usage in extreme cold | Reduces stress on the system when flow is slow |
